Birth Date: February 21, 1676

Birth Location: Concord, Middlesex, Massachusetts Bay, British Colonial America

Death Date: April 27, 1741

Death Location: Middletown, Hartford, Connecticut, British Colonial America

Father:

Mother: Mary Stowe

Spouse(s): Experience Hall

In 1676, Samuel Cotton entered the world in Concord, Middlesex, Massachusetts Bay, British Colonial America, born to Reverend John Scott Cotton Sr And Mary Marie Spaulding Stowe. Samuel Cotton married Experience Hall, Lydiah Bates, and had children including Daniel Cotton, Ebenezer Cotton, Elizabeth Cotton, First Lieutenant John Cotton, Hannah Cotton, Lydia Cotton, Phebe Cotton, Prudence Cotton, Samuel Cotton Jr, William Cotton. Samuel Cotton passed away in 1741 in Middletown, Hartford, Connecticut, British Colonial America.
